CHICAGO — A 19-year-old man was shot in Hyde Park Tuesday night, police said.

At 7:52 p.m., the man was shot in his shoulder while sitting in a car in the 5100 block of South Drexel Avenue by an unknown gunman in a passing car, according the University of Chicago Police.

He was taken to the University of Chicago Hospitals in fair condition, said Officer Jose Estrada, a Chicago Police spokesman.

No one is in custody for the shooting.
